I've been fascinated by forensic biology and want to pursue a degree in this field. Can anyone recommend colleges with strong forensic biology programs that offer hands-on lab experiences or partnerships with crime labs?
Absolutely, it's exciting to see your interest in Forensic Biology. Top colleges renowned for their strong programs in the field that include excellent lab experiences and partnerships can be found across the country, and I'll highlight a few here.
1. Pennsylvania State University: Offering a B.S. in Forensic Science, Penn State delivers an interdisciplinary program that combines core science curriculum with law enforcement and criminalistics, providing hands-on opportunities like crime scene simulations and lab work.
2. University of Central Florida: UCF’s Forensic Science program has two tracks, both Analysis and Biochemistry, and engages with the National Center for Forensic Science on their campus, providing great opportunity for practical experience.
3. Loyola University Chicago: They offer different concentration options in Forensic Science, with one specifically in Biology. They also have solid partnerships with local crime labs, including the Cook County Medical Examiner's Office.
4. Texas A&M University: Tamu offers a B.S in Forensic and Investigative Sciences. It is one of the only programs in the country accredited by the Forensic Science Education Programs Accreditation Commission (FEPAC), guaranteeing its quality.
5. University of California, Davis: The UC Davis Forensic Science Graduate Program is a great option for those thinking about their future, as it combines broad coursework in biology and chemistry, and offers opportunities for students to conduct their own independent research.
While many others exist, these provide a snapshot into some great programs. Remember, when assessing any program, make sure to consider its courses, faculty, lab facilities, partnerships for practicums, and student outcomes like job placement rates. This will help ensure the program aligns with both your career goals and academic interests.
